Annie Lorine Robertson Goddard age 95 of Lenoir City passed away Wednesday morning, July 17, 2019 at Trinity Healthcare Center. She was of the Methodist faith. Lorine worked at Eaton School for over 30 years in the cafeteria. Preceded in death by her husband, Marcus E. Goddard; parents, George Leroy Robertson and Delia Robertson; sisters, Georgia (LeRoy) Shoaf, Catherine (Thomas) Carter, Mable (Raymond) Laird, and Onell Robertson; brothers, Spencer (Bernice) Robertson, Paul Robertson, Johnny (Francis) Robertson, and Robert (Gertrude) Robertson. Survived by her children: Norven (Cleo) Goddard and Terry (Ann) Goddard; grandchildren: Amy Goddard, Jeani Varner and Tony Goddard; great-grandchildren: Joshua Varner, Morgan Varner, Kaylin Goddard, Jim Robinson, and Burns Robinson; sister-in-law, Marie Robertson; several nieces and nephews. Friends may call at their convenience at Click Funeral Home in Lenoir City. Family and friends will gather at 1 p.m. on Friday, July 19th at the Abbott Cemetery for graveside services with Rev. Eddie Click officiating. Click Funeral Home, 109 Walnut Street, Lenoir City is in charge of arrangements.
